Friday, November 7th

Cooler days and nights call for a good book! Alsager Book Emporium in Hassall Road is open 10 am – 2 pm. Plenty of books to buy, many of them brand new!

(Photo: Nub News)

Saturday, November 8th

Alsager Animals in Need has its monthly coffee morning at Alsager Civic. This month it's a Christmas Special which takes place as usual from 9.30 am until 11.30 am with 50p entry.

We have a good range of items including clothes, books, jewellery, bric-a-brac, plants, pet items, home-made cakes, raffle/tombola and extra Christmas tables. Good chance to pick up some bargains!

Do you love art? There's an exhibition on in Alsager until 10 January which shouldn't be missed. It's on in the upstairs gallery at the Two Doors Studio in Crewe Road. The gallery is open during usual shop hours. Admission is free. Entry to the exhibition is via the Two Doors Studio front door on Crewe Road. https://www.twodoorsstudio.co.uk/

Alsager Town aka The Bullets are playing Shawbury United away with a 3 pm kick-off. Show them your support!

In the evening, Alsager Round Table has one of its biggest charity events of the year - the annual bonfire night at The Plough Inn in Crewe Road. The fairground opens at 4.30 pm, the bonfire is lit at 5 pm and the fireworks start at 6.30 pm. Full details in our story here

Sunday, November 9th

It's Alsager's Remembrance parade at the War Memorial in Sandbach Road South. Those taking part in the parade are meeting in Asda car park at 2.30 pm.

(Photo: Nub News)

Still celebrating Guy Fawkes? The Lawton Arms in Church Lawton, which had a new landlord earlier this year, has a firework event. The pub car park will be closed for the event. Rides from 3pm and a food stall will be open from 4pm. The fireworks will now start at 7pm (please note the time change from 6pm).
